Frequently asked questions

What is there to see and do in Santa Teresa?
The picturesque setting of Cocal Mayo Hot Springs and Historic Sanctuary of Machu Picchu showcase the area's natural beauty. Discover sights such as Apurímac River and Urubamba River during your stay. You'll also discover lots of options for restaurants in Santa Teresa.
When is the best time to book a hotel with a pool in Santa Teresa?
You may want to think about a place to stay that has an outdoor pool if you're planning to visit Santa Teresa in the driest months of June, July, or August when the average rainfall is 2 inches. Lodging that has a pool indoors may be the way to go if you are visiting during the rainiest months of January, February, and December when the average rainfall is 10 inches.
